Well it's metal instead of ceramic, so the chances of it busting up is less, and it appears the cells are bigger.
I did some reading and they do flow a tiny bit more, and are more resistant to heat (the ceramic ones use a cheap ceramic that isn't high temp like most ceramics) so they work well if you are boosted and running rich.
